技术文摘
React Query数据库插件与第三方库的集成指南
React Query数据库插件与第三方库的集成指南
在React应用开发中,集成数据库插件与第三方库能极大提升开发效率与应用功能。React Query作为强大的状态管理工具,在与各类数据库插件及第三方库集成时,为开发者带来诸多便利。
理解React Query核心概念是集成的基础。它负责数据获取与缓存管理,通过简洁API让开发者轻松处理异步数据。比如在获取服务器数据时,能自动缓存响应,减少不必要请求,提升应用性能。
与数据库插件集成方面,以常用的SQLite数据库为例。先安装相关数据库驱动和React Query适配库,接着创建数据库连接配置。在React组件中,利用React Query的useQuery钩子函数,将数据库查询操作包装起来。例如,查询数据库中用户列表数据,可将查询逻辑封装在回调函数中作为useQuery第一个参数。这样,数据获取过程被React Query有效管理,数据变化时能及时更新组件UI。
第三方库集成同样重要。以图表库Chart.js为例,若要展示数据库中数据的可视化图表,需先从数据库获取数据,再将数据传递给Chart.js。借助React Query,在获取数据阶段确保数据稳定可靠。在组件中,获取到数据后,根据Chart.js的格式要求进行数据处理和配置。比如将数据库中的销售数据转化为适合柱状图展示的数据格式,通过React Query缓存数据,下次渲染图表时无需重新获取,提高图表绘制速度。
集成过程中,要注意错误处理。React Query提供完善的错误处理机制,在数据获取失败时,能及时捕获错误并展示友好提示给用户。注意不同库版本兼容性,确保集成过程顺利。
通过合理集成React Query数据库插件与第三方库,开发者能高效构建数据驱动、性能卓越的React应用,为用户带来流畅体验,满足各种复杂业务需求。
TAGS: 第三方库 React Query 集成指南 数据库插件
- React移动端适配:优化前端应用在不同屏幕的显示效果方法
- 编写自定义React Query数据库插件方法
- 深入解析Css Flex弹性布局的换行及溢出处理方式
- React Router 使用教程:前端路由控制实现方法
- Css Flex 弹性布局助力移动端网页加载速度优化方法
- CSS布局之Positions技巧与移动端网页开发要点
- 借助 CSS Positions 布局构建响应式网页的方法
- CSS Positions布局优化秘籍:加速网页加载的实用技巧
- React Query 里数据库查询索引与优化器的优化策略
- js函数function的用法
- css清除position的方法
- 父元素设置position的原因
- 前端规避重绘与回流的方法
- 虚拟 DOM 是如何降低重绘与回流的
- CSS 选择器中的属性选择器有哪些